Dent Moses Partner and Manager Honored by UAB Collat School of Business and Birmingham Business Journal

Dent Moses Managing Partner, Mike Baker was named 2019 Accounting Alumnus of the Year, while Manager, Jessica Bou Akar was recognized as the 2019 Accounting Young Alumnus of the Year by the University of Alabama Collat School of Business. This is the first year the Accounting Young Alumnus award was presented making  Bou Akar the first to receive this prestigious award.

Presented at a reception on April 26, 2019, these awards recognized Baker and Bou Akar’s support and active involvement with UAB Collat School of Business and the accounting department.

Jessica Bou Akar has also been named as one of Birmingham Business Journal’s 2019 Rising Stars of Money. This special feature in the May 3 issue, honors up-and-coming leaders who are already making waves in the banking, finance, private equity, investment banking, financial planning and wealth management sectors. All honorees are under 30 and selected based on their accomplishments to date, their contributions to their companies, and their potential to become an industry leader.

Mike Baker has served as Managing Partner at Dent Moses since 2016 focusing on the areas of taxation and general business consulting. He also heads the firm’s legal and engineering segments. Mike is a Certified Accounting Professional (CPA), as well as a Certified Financial Planner (CFP) with Series 7 and Series 63 licenses from the National Association of Securities Dealers. He is a member of the American Institute of CPAs (AICPA), the Alabama Society of CPAs (ASCPA) and the Financial Planning Institute (FPA).

Baker received his accounting equivalency from the University of Alabama Birmingham after receiving his B.S. in Mechanical Engineering at Auburn University. As an UAB alumnus, he serves as the Chairman of the UAB Accounting Advisory Board.

As a manager at Dent Moses, Jessica Bou Akar provides assurance and taxation assistance to various industries including wholesale distribution, professional services firms, employee benefit plans, and not-for-profits. Jessica is a member of the Alabama Society of Certified Public Accountants (ASCPA) and the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A). She received her B.S. in Accounting and Master’s of Accountancy from the University of Alabama Birmingham.
